Transponder Keys

In contrast to flat metal keys that operate mechanically by cutting the top and bottom, transponder (a portmanteau of transmitter and responder) keys have an electronic microchip within their key heads. When the key is put into an automobile equipped with transponder tech the chip sends a low-level message to a receiver near the ignition switch. If the chip is programmed to transmit this signal, it will cause the engine to turn on. Transponder chips are made to stop theft of cars which is why a majority of modern vehicles have them.

Transponder technology was first utilized in World War II, when encoded messages were sent over radio frequencies to determine whether the aircraft that was incoming was friendly or hostile. The same idea was later applied to car keys in the form of General Motors creating the first transponder chip keys in 1985 for its Corvette model. Since then, they've become commonplace on new vehicles, and can also be retrofitted into older models.

If you own a vehicle that has this type of security system, it is recommended to always have a spare transponder key at hand, as it will only work only if the chip has been scanned properly. It's not foolproof. There are some who have discovered ways to fool this system. They include kits and tutorials explaining how to bypass the transponder by using wires and electrical relays.

Proximity Keys

311159893_995841588058766_62139640281361Proximity keys are the newest keyless entry technologies, which are becoming more popular on a number of vehicles. The key fob can be carried in a pocket, or bag and used to unlock the car. The key fob connects to the vehicle, removing immobilisers from the vehicle and permitting it to start.

310300814_438157535072560_44143179768643There are a few disadvantages to proximity key systems, though. If the key fob is lost or damaged it isn't able to start the car. A locksmith or a dealership will need to replace it, which can be expensive. Batteries also power the fobs, so they'll need to be replaced periodically.

The proximity key technology also has the disadvantage of breaking the cause-and-effect cycle that we are all familiar with when using physical keys. When you use a traditional key and the lock opens, you know that you have the key. With proximity-sensing keys, you'll have to be within a certain distance of the vehicle to activate it.

Despite their downsides proximity keys are a great invention for drivers who do not want to lock themselves out of their car. A keyless entry system sends encrypted signals to an inside receiver. The receiver detects the signal and then unlocks or starts the engine. It can also detect the presence of an individual driver and adjust settings to suit their preferences. It will shut the door, for instance, the driver has an item in his hand.

While the majority of keyless entry systems are secure, some of them are vulnerable to attacks. For instance, a replay attack is when the original remote control signal is recorded, and then transmitted to the device at a later date. This can be prevented by incorporating an algorithm into the keyless entry system that ensures each transmission is distinct from the previous one.
